        Design principles
        =================
        
        There exist many different quantum computing backends. The idea with
        this library was to abstract them away so that code running written
        using the library could be run on other backends, provided that the rest
        of the code not composed of functions defined by the library is not
        backend specific.
        
        To do this, we instantiate the library by giving it a mapping and a
        node. The mapping is the translation of the backend specific way of
        calling elementary quantum operations, while the node is the actual
        quantum registers that are available to perform the computation. The
        node usually contains also some additional functions such as sending
        qubits to other nodes, receiving and sending entanglement etc. The
        differences have been abstracted away with the mappings for
        ``simulaqron`` and ``qunetsim`` . Other mappings have been considered
        and used but not made available most notably for ``Netsquid``.

        Testing
        =======
        
        Tests can be run using ``python setup.py test`` at the root of the
        repository.
        
        The repository includes a tests directory that contains the file
        ``test_qpz_atomics.py`` which gathers all the tests implemented. It is
        using the ``pytest`` package to launch the tests and gather statistics,
        while being based on ``hypothesis`` for generating examples.
        
        For the tests to run, you need to have a quatum network simulator
        available and running. We have chosen to implement the tests using
        ``simulaqron`` as a backend, hence requiring a running simulaqron
        instance. This can be done typing the following:
        
        .. code:: bash
        
            simulaqron set max-qubits 100
            simulaqron start
        
        Other backends could be used provided the tests are rewritten and the
        required backend is available and properly mapped in the library.
